My guest for Episode #307 of the My Favorite Mistake podcast is Terry Whalin, an accomplished editor and author of more than 60 books, several of which have sold over 100,000 copies. Terry is the owner of Whalin and Associates, a communications firm, and he serves as an acquisitions editor for Morgan James Publishing. Drawing from decades of experience in both writing and publishing, Terry shares a favorite mistake that changed the course of his career—offering valuable insights for first-time authors and seasoned professionals alike. Episode page with video and more His most recent book is 10 Publishing Myths: Insights Every Author Needs to Succeed. Terry's favorite mistake took place in 2007, when a high-profile publishing event jolted him into realizing just how little he was doing to promote his own books. Despite having secured multiple six-figure advances and a long list of published titles, Terry was receiving negative royalty statements—his books weren't earning out. That wake-up call led him to take what he calls 100% responsibility for his own success, adopting a daily commitment to book promotion, content creation, and building an online presence. From that turning point, he launched a blog (now with over 1,700 posts), grew a substantial social media following, and became a consistent voice in the author education space. In the conversation, Terry and Mark explore the myths and realities of book publishing—especially the misconception that a publisher will handle marketing. Terry outlines how today's authors must become active promoters, the importance of building an email list you control, and why giving away ebooks can actually drive print book sales. He also shares hard-earned lessons about evaluating publishers, avoiding scams, and understanding how traditional and independent publishing models differ. Whether you're writing your first book or navigating your next launch, Terry's insights are a masterclass in professional ownership and long-term thinking. Send us a textTerry Whalin opens up about his extraordinary path to becoming a "super author" with over 60 books published and many selling more than 100,000 copies each. What began with an observant high school English teacher recognizing his talent led to journalism school, an unexpected spiritual awakening, and eventually a career that spans biographies of figures like Billy Graham to practical guides for aspiring authors.The turning point in Terry's career came when he realized he wasn't taking enough responsibility for his own success. Despite having dozens of books with traditional publishers, sales remained disappointing until he attended a marketing conference where he embraced Jack Canfield's principle of taking 100% responsibility for outcomes. This shifted everything. Terry began consistently blogging weekly—now with over 1,700 entries—and implementing strategic marketing approaches that transformed his publishing career.Terry shares invaluable wisdom for writers at every stage, revealing how the creators of Chicken Soup for the Soul were rejected 160 times before finding success, how they implemented the "rule of five" to promote daily, and why consistency matters more than occasional brilliance. He dispels common publishing myths, including the expectation of significant earnings, and explains why building your platform on owned channels (your website, blog, and newsletter) provides more stability than relying on social media. In the beginning stages of writing a book, most people start with a blank page and write their entire manuscript. According to author and acquisitions editor W. Terry Whalin, this approach is backwards. About 80% to 90% of nonfiction books are sold from a book proposal. This mysterious document called a proposal contains many elements that will never appear in a manuscript—yet these details are critical to publishing executives who make the decision about publishing or rejecting an author's project. In Book Proposals That Sell, Terry reveals 21 secrets to creating a book proposal that every author needs in order to create one that sells.Terry Whalin is an editor and author of more than 60 books and has written for more than 50 magazines. If you and I were having coffee together, and I asked if you believed in the Tooth Fairy or Santa Claus, you'd probably reply, “No, those are nice ideas but they're not real because they're myths.” It's pretty easy for us to distinguish reality from fiction when it comes to figures like Santa Claus. However, it's not so easy for writers to distinguish fact from fiction when it comes to publishing. That's why I'm glad my friend Terry Whalin is here to help us dispel publishing myths that can lead you astray. Let me tell you a bit about him. Terry Whalin understands both sides of the editorial desk. A former literary agent, Terry is an Acquisitions Editor at Morgan James Publishing. He has written more than 60 books for traditional publishers and several books have sold over 100,000 copies. Terry has also written for more than 50 magazines. As a frustrated editor in 2004, Terry wrote Book Proposals That Sell: 21 Secrets to Speed Your Success, which has nearly 200 5-star reviews and has helped many authors. Terry is an active member of the American Society of Journalists and Authors and lives in Southern California. Today we're here to talk about another one of his fantastic book, which is 10 Publishing Myths: Insights Every Author Needs to Succeed. These are some of the myths we discuss (you'll love these!): My publisher will sell and promote my book. Writing a book will make me famous. I can't call myself a writer unless I publish a book. The editor will fix all my mistakes. Good writers are born, not made. My book will be a NYT bestseller. The life of a writer is glamourous.
